2024年,全球物理治疗设备市场规模达186亿美元,预计到2034年将以6.5%的复合年增长率成长,达到353亿美元。推动这一增长的因素包括神经系统疾病发病率的上升、医疗设备的技术进步以及人们对各种健康状况治疗方案认识的提高。人们对手术和损伤后復健的日益关注,刺激了对物理治疗服务和设备的需求。

此外,雷射治疗仪、运动器材和电疗设备等设备在临床环境中至关重要,有助于加速患者復健并改善整体健康状况。这些设备在提供有针对性且有效的復健解决方案方面发挥着至关重要的作用,尤其对于正在从手术、受伤或慢性病中恢復的患者而言。透过提供针对性的治疗,它们有助于缓解疼痛、增强肌肉力量并促进组织癒合,使其成为当代医疗保健中不可或缺的工具。对于需要恢復活动能力或从重大医疗程序中恢復的患者,雷射治疗仪、电疗机和运动器材等设备可以透过促进血液循环、减少发炎和提高肌肉柔软度来加速康復。除了支持身体復健之外,这些设备还透过提供传统疼痛管理技术的非侵入性替代方案,促进患者的整体健康。

预计物理治疗设备市场将以6.2%的复合年增长率成长,到2034年将达到219亿美元。随着越来越多的患者因各种疾病接受手术,对电疗和冷冻疗法等有效復健解决方案的需求也随之增长。超音波疗法用于治疗肌肉骨骼疼痛并促进组织更快癒合,因其在缓解膝盖、臀部和背部等部位的慢性不适方面效果显着而尤其受欢迎。这些疗法正变得越来越普遍,全球成千上万的患者从中受益。

从不同的应用角度来看,市场细分为神经内科、肌肉骨骼和心血管护理等领域,每个领域都服务于不同的患者需求。肌肉骨骼领域市场规模在2024年达到89亿美元,由于行动不便和肌肉骨骼损伤的日益普遍,该领域正在经历显着增长。随着人口老化以及关节炎、关节痛和骨质疏鬆症等疾病发生率的上升,对缓解不适和促进活动能力的疗法的需求也随之增加。

2024年,美国物理治疗设备市场规模达64亿美元,预计2025年至2034年期间的复合年增长率将达到5.5%。人口老化以及心血管疾病和癌症等慢性疾病患者人数的增加,推动了物理治疗服务需求的成长。此外,报销政策的出台以及个人自行转诊至物理治疗师的便利性,也有助于扩大医疗服务的可及性,并推动市场成长。

全球物理治疗设备市场的主要参与者采用各种策略来巩固其地位。 BTL Corporate、Dynatronics 和 Mettler Electronics 等公司专注于产品创新,例如开发先进的超音波和电疗机,以满足市场对有效復健工具日益增长的需求。一些公司也正在扩大在新兴市场的业务,以挖掘新的客户群;而其他公司则投资与医疗保健提供者建立合作伙伴关係,以改善服务。透过整合尖端技术并提供客製化解决方案,EMS Physio 和 Zimmer MedizinSysteme 等公司旨在获得竞争优势并提升客户满意度。

The Global Physiotherapy Equipment Market was valued at USD 18.6 billion in 2024 and is estimated to grow at a CAGR of 6.5% to reach USD 35.3 billion by 2034, driven by a variety of factors, including a rise in neurological disorders, technological advancements in medical equipment, and increased awareness about treatment options for various health conditions. The growing focus on rehabilitation and recovery from surgeries and injuries has fueled demand for physiotherapy services and equipment.

Additionally, devices like laser therapy units, exercise machines, and electrotherapy equipment are essential in clinical environments, helping to speed up patient recovery and improve overall health. These devices play a vital role in providing targeted and effective rehabilitation solutions, particularly for patients recovering from surgery, injuries, or managing chronic conditions. By delivering focused treatments, they aid in pain relief, enhance muscle strength, and promote tissue healing, making them indispensable tools in contemporary healthcare. For patients who need to regain mobility or recover from serious medical procedures, devices like laser therapy units, electrotherapy machines, and exercise equipment accelerate recovery by stimulating circulation, reducing inflammation, and improving muscle flexibility. In addition to supporting physical recovery, these devices contribute to the overall well-being of patients by offering non-invasive alternatives to traditional pain management techniques.

The physiotherapy equipment segment is expected to grow at a CAGR of 6.2%, reaching USD 21.9 billion by 2034. As more patients undergo surgeries for different conditions, the demand for effective rehabilitation solutions, such as electrotherapy and cryotherapy, has risen. Ultrasound therapy, which is used to treat musculoskeletal pain and promote faster tissue healing, is particularly popular due to its effectiveness in managing chronic discomfort in areas like the knee, hip, and back. These therapies are becoming increasingly common, with thousands of patients worldwide benefiting from them.

When looking at the various applications, the market is segmented into areas such as neurology, musculoskeletal, and cardiovascular care, each serving distinct patient needs. The musculoskeletal segment, valued at USD 8.9 billion in 2024, is experiencing significant growth due to the increasing prevalence of mobility issues and musculoskeletal impairments. As the population ages and the incidence of conditions like arthritis, joint pain, and osteoporosis rises, there is a greater demand for therapies that alleviate discomfort and promote mobility.

United States Physiotherapy Equipment Market was valued at USD 6.4 billion in 2024 and will grow at a CAGR of 5.5% from 2025 to 2034. The aging population and the increasing number of people suffering from chronic conditions like cardiovascular diseases and cancer contribute to the growing demand for physiotherapy services. Additionally, reimbursement policies and the ability for individuals to self-refer to physiotherapists are helping expand access to care and driving market growth.

Key players in the Global Physiotherapy Equipment Market employ various strategies to strengthen their positions. Companies like BTL Corporate, Dynatronics, and Mettler Electronics are focusing on product innovation, such as the development of advanced ultrasound and electrotherapy machines, to meet the growing demand for effective rehabilitation tools. Some firms are also expanding their presence in emerging markets to tap into new customer bases, while others are investing in partnerships with healthcare providers to improve service offerings. By incorporating cutting-edge technology and providing tailored solutions, companies like EMS Physio and Zimmer MedizinSysteme aim to gain a competitive edge and enhance customer satisfaction.
